Juniper & Thorn by Ava Reid
3.0
ehh this was fine. There was parts I really liked about this, and parts I very much didn't like about this, and for a barely 300 page book it read extremely slow. The writing was great and Reid uses a lyrical style that I like a lot, but toward the end everything kind of started to get muddled together.
I'm interested in reading more from this author but this one is definitely hit or miss.
